    Additional entry requirements

    To make sure this delivery option is the right fit for you, we will need you to demonstrate that you can meet the additional requirements below.

    • Language, Literacy and Numeracy (LLN) evidence will be required for successfull enrolment in this course. This can be provided by prevoius evidence of education or participating in the RU Ready program.

    • To successfully complete this course you will be required to participate in role plays which will be video recorded and the video submitted for marking. You should arrange for persons over 18, such as colleagues, friends or family members, or fellow online students who are available and willing to participate in a role play to fulfil certain unit requirements that will be recoded and subsequently uploaded and submitted for marking.

    Units

    Units taught in this course

    Courses are made up of a combination of both core and specialty units. In the Certificate IV in Real Estate Practice qualification, you’ll need to successfully complete 18 units of competency, including 5 core and 13 speciality units.

    Core units are central to the job outcomes of a particular industry or occupation. These are the units industry has agreed are essential to be capable and qualified at a particular study level.

    • Prepare for professional practice in real estateCPPREP4001

    • Access and interpret ethical practice in real estateCPPREP4002

    • Establish marketing and communication profiles in real estateCPPREP4004

    • Prepare to work with real estate trust accountsCPPREP4005

    Course delivery

    Studying Online

    Learn online. Unlike virtual classrooms, you won't have a timetable. All your course content will be available online for you to access at any time of the day from a computer with internet access.

    Your online course will include collaboration with your teacher and other students through online platforms. Your teachers are available and will provide you with support throughout the course.

    You may be required to attend a vocational work placement, on campus assessment and/or a teacher might need to observe and assess you in a real or simulated environment.
